Admission Procedures

Procedure for Admissions to Master’s in Landscape Architecture (MLA) Program, Faculty of Architecture for the Academic year 2026 – 27

National Applicants

For M.Arch.

B.Arch. degree recognized by the Council of Architecture. Minimum 50% aggregate marks for general category and 45% for reserved category.

For M.A.

A first professional undergraduate degree (Bachelor’s Degree) in Landscape Architecture, Interior Design or Urban design disciplines with at least four full-time academic years in duration offered by a UGC recognized University or Institution. Minimum 50% aggregate marks for general category and 45% for reserved category.

International Applicants

For M.Arch.

B.Arch. or equivalent degree in Architecture with minimum 50% aggregate marks.

Provided that the Architecture program is considered equivalent to the B.Arch. degree program by the Equivalence Committee of CEPT University.

For M.A.

A first professional undergraduate degree (Bachelor’s Degree) in Landscape Architecture, Interior Design or Urban design disciplines with at least four full-time academic years in duration offered by a recognized University or Institution, with a minimum of 50% aggregate marks.

Sponsored Candidates

Same as for national applicants + Minimum 5 years [on the last date of application] of experience in relevant field, of which at Least two years in service of the organization sponsoring his/her study.

Disqualification / scrutiny

Incomplete application documents, evidence of providing false information, plagiarism in portfolio/report [zero tolerance policy towards plagiarism], not meeting eligibility criteria will result in disqualification of the application.

Application Information & Requirements

The application shall consist of the following:

  1. A completed application form.
  2. CEPT PG Test / GATE Scores for Indian nationals. The candidates who have appeared for the GATE exam are not required to appear for CEPT PG Test. It is compulsory to give CEPT PG test if you have not appeared for GATE. CEPT PG Test will be online from your home.

    GRE scores for international candidates (GRE scores shall be considered valid if taken within the last 2 years). International candidates can appear for CEPT PG Test, if they have not taken GRE. CEPT PG Test will be online from your home. 

  3. Self-attested Degree certificates, and mark sheets for all semesters. Applicants receiving grades as GPA/CGPA need to send a document indicating the equivalent percentage marks or relationship of GPA/CGPA with percentage marks as per their university/ institute along with all the mark sheets. Applicants studying in the final semester need to submit all the mark sheets till the penultimate semester.
  4. Curriculum Vitae.
  5. Academic and/ or Professional experience certificates. The referee should be able to upload the reference letters till 3 days after the last date to apply.
  6. References from two referees who know you well. Referees must be your professional superiors or academic instructors / tutors. References from peers, colleagues, friends and family will be disqualified. (Online reference letters to be filled and sent directly by the referee)
  7. Portfolio: Attach a maximum of 10 pages of A4 size in landscape format as a single PDF file. File size should not exceed 20 MB and 150 dpi maximum. Please note that pages after the first 10 pages in your portfolio, as specified, may not be considered for evaluation. Bear in mind that portfolio reviewers will not be zooming in to review your portfolios and arrange your pages accordingly. (See below for details)
  8. Online interview with the shortlisted candidates.
  9. GATE cut off: Applicants who have received the score below cutoff score as published by the relevant authority, he/she needs to appear for online CEPT PG Test.

Refer Evaluation Procedure for details on all the above requirements.

National Students

The entire evaluation process is online. It is mandatory to appear for all the stages of evaluation for the admission process. Evaluation shall be done in two stages.

Stage 1 – 

All applications will be screened at this stage in the following manner:

  1. Check eligibility of the candidate from the uploaded documents.
  2. An expert evaluation committee will be set up by the program to assess documents and portfolios to shortlist eligible candidates for the program.
  3. Documents required and the assessment criteria for this stage are follows:

Documents Required

A. Curriculum vitae, work experience, and last qualifying exam marks
Assessment Criteria

  • Relevance and Quality of Experience in a work environment
  • Relevance and quality of engagement in an academic environment (workshops, seminars, conferences, extra classes, short courses)
  • Relevance and quality of extra-curricular activities.

B. Last Qualifying Exam 
Assessment Criteria
Performance in the last qualifying exam of your undergraduate program will be noted

C. References
Assessment Criteria
Please share the link provided in the application form with the referees. (Referees are kindly required to submit the online reference form, including a reference letter, to assist the University in making a full assessment of each applicant’s academic record and abilities)

It is necessary to have one academic and one professional reference. In case the applicant has not graduated, provide two academic references.

The reference shall be evaluated for:

1. Relevance of the Reference (and the Referee) with the subject matter

2. Nature of Reference received

3. Authenticity of the Reference

4. Content of the reference

5. Evaluation of referee

D. Portfolio
The portfolio is a synopsis of one's creative work. As a visual essay, it tells the story of a person's interests, skills, and development over time. It should include projects that best express one's visual, spatial, and constructional abilities.

The portfolio must conform to following :

1. Contain a maximum of 10 pages in A4 landscape format

2. The portfolio should be a single pdf

3. Maximum size of portfolio shall be 20MB with 150 dpi resolution

4. All drawings and text should be of optimum size and legible for screen viewing  without zooming in.

5. Pages after the first 10 pages in your portfolio (including cover), will not be considered for evaluation

6. The portfolio should have a three parts:

  • Cover page- with name, name of institution, year of graduation and portfolio content
  • Academic work
  • Professional and other works section

7. Academic work

This section should include three fully developed individual design projects that best represent the candidate’s aptitude, communication and design skills.

Thesis - This should include thesis project. If thesis is in progress currently - include a 500 word synopsis and process drawings.  Please provide contact details of the thesis guide in the index.

Internship - It is not mandatory to include internship work.   If including work done during this period, it will be a part of the academic section. This should preferably be restricted to one spread and should mention office name, project name, duration of work, and nature of involvement. Please provide contact details of the office in the index.

Group work - If including group work it needs to be specified with due credits to the team. It should mention the nature of involvement of the candidate.  Names of all group members should be mentioned in the index.

Professional / other works section

The first preference should be to individual projects, if any. In office work, give priority to a project which you were involved in for a longer duration.  It should mention office name, duration, and project name, status of completion, year, and nature of involvement / role. Please provide contact details of the office in the index.

This section can also include works that show specific skills and interests like writing, sketching, workshops attended and other related areas.

The portfolio will be evaluated for:

1. Competence to coherently demonstrate visual and spatial abilities expressed through a basic understanding of material and construction at the minimum.

2. The ability of a candidate to demonstrate spatial fluency and intellectual depth in contemporary research questions and critical areas of inquiry

3. Authenticity of the Portfolio (signed and stamped by the institution/ office/ organization)

4. Proper credits and references

5. Plagiarism (zero tolerance)

6. Legible and clean format

7. Judicious use of space

8. Communication of information

E. Test Scores (CEPT PG / GATE)

It is mandatory to appear for all the evaluation criteria. If a candidate is absent from any of the evaluation criteria, he/she is not qualified to be considered for the merit list.

"Experience" is one of the evaluation criteria. If an applicant has a continuing position at the workplace, at the time of application, his/her experience will be accounted for till the date of application deadline irrespective of the date of submission of application.

Stage 2
108 candidates (three times the intake capacity) will be invited for stage 2. The assessment process for this stage will be completely through an online interview.

Online Interview - All qualified applications for stage 2 will be screened by an expert evaluation committee. This will be set up by the program to conduct online interviews and assess the academic and professional experience/ motivation, skills, understanding of current issues and communication skills.

International Students

The admission procedure and assessment criteria is the same for national, international, and sponsored candidates unless specifically mentioned otherwise. GRE scores for international candidates (GRE score shall be considered valid if taken within the last 2 years).

The mode of teaching for the program is in English. The proficiency in English language should be good. The International candidates should rate their proficiency in English language at the scale of 1 to 5 in the application form.

Sponsored Candidates

The admission procedure and assessment criteria are the same for national, international, and sponsored candidates unless specifically mentioned otherwise.

The candidates will be required to submit the following in addition to other documents:

  • Sponsorship Certificate and/or No Objection certificate from the last employer
  • Proof of Employment that may include the
  1. Appointment letter
  2. Form No. 16 for the last two years from the last employer
  3. Experience certificate(s) indicating minimum experience of 5 years
  4. Any other proof as deemed necessary by the committee

Separate merit list will be prepared for seats of sponsored candidates. In absence of enough eligible applications or applicants qualified in the admission procedure, the seats will be filled with the other eligible and qualified candidates.

For candidates with B.Arch. the degree awarded - Master of Architecture (Landscape Design)

For candidates with other than B.Arch. the degree awarded - Master of Arts (Landscape Design)

CEPT University offers a number of Merit and Means based scholarships. Merit-based scholarships are offered to applicants along with their admission offer letter based on their standing in the admissions merit list. Applicants can apply for means-based scholarships on the online admissions portal after they have submitted their admission application.
